Position Summary
Responsible for ensuring smooth operation of machinery and mechanical equipment to include installation of equipment, when necessary, regular services, preventative maintenance and the ability to trouble shoot equipment breakdowns. Advanced mechanical knowledge of industry machinery is essential.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Performing daily preventative equipment maintenance
- Knowledge of pneumatic and Hydraulics.
- Basic Electrical a bonus.
- Performing troubleshooting on mechanical issues.
- Initiating equipment repairs.
- Performing detailed machine maintenance.
- Day to day coverage of production equipment - respond to breakdowns, and production requests, quickly and efficiently to minimize downtime.
- Experience and knowledge of plumbing and welding are a plus.
- Ensures work is performed safely and efficiently.
- Maintains accurate and timely records of maintenance performed.
- Complies with all Federal, State and local laws.
- Proficient in the use of power and hand tools.
- Complete work orders and record material utilized on job.
- Assist with preventative maintenance as assigned.
- All other duties assigned
